About ZIP Code 08244

ZIP code 08244 is located in Somers Point, New Jersey, within Atlantic County. With a population of 10,611, this is a lightly populated ZIP code with a middle-aged community — the median age is 43.9 years. Economically, 08244 is a solidly middle-class ZIP code: the median household income of $67,500 is near the national average.

Real estate in ZIP code 08244 represents a mid-range housing market. The median home value of $278,500 is near the national average. Renters can expect to pay around $1,266 per month in median rent. The area has a relatively balanced mix of owners (50.1%) and renters (49.9%). Median home values have increased by 25% since 2019.

The population of 08244 is primarily White (70.19%). Residents are well-educated — 41.4% hold a bachelor's degree or higher, which is near the national average. Poverty affects some residents at 11.1%. Household income has grown by 10% since 2019.

The unemployment rate in 08244 stands at 9.4%, which is significantly above the national average. As in most parts of the country, driving alone is the dominant commute mode at 78%.

Overall, ZIP code 08244 in Somers Point, NJ is characterized as solidly middle-class, well-educated, and a middle-aged community. With 10,611 residents, a median household income of $67,500, and a median home value of $278,500, it offers a clear picture of life in this part of New Jersey.
